The Grace of Noticing: The Sacred Pause that Changes Ordinary Days invites you to slow down just enough to discover that God is not hiding in extraordinary moments alone. He is already present in the ordinary rhythms of your life—at the kitchen table, in the grocery store aisle, during a quiet conversation, in the middle of work, grief, or waiting.
This reflective and deeply human book explores what happens when we pause long enough to truly see. Through personal stories, Scripture, and gentle spiritual insight, The Grace of Noticing helps you awaken to the sacred hidden in familiar places. You will learn how attention becomes a form of love, how presence deepens faith, and how ordinary days can quietly become holy ground.
You do not need a different life to encounter God more deeply.
You simply need eyes to see Him in the life you already have.
The Grace of Noticing is an invitation to slow your pace, soften your heart, and discover the quiet nearness of God in places you may have overlooked all along.
